Find your dancing shoes pronto as there’s a new competitive music game on the horizon, Super Dodgeball Beats, and it’s going to put your rhythm to the test. Playstack and Final Boss Games have just announced the release date for its arrival on Xbox One, PlayStation 4, Nintendo Switch and PC.
Inspired by classics like Elite Beat Agents, Rhythm Paradise and even Taiko no Tatsujin, Super Dodgeball Beats tells the story of a rag-tag group of friends living in a world where dodgeball hysteria has hit its peak and taken over the world of mainstream sport. Hence, these failing school mates decide to form a team and enter their very first tournament, which they actually end up winning.
Looking to capitalise on the victory, their next goal is to be National Major League champions. Unfortunately though, that means they’ll have to defeat teams comprised of blood-thirsty vampires, electric-infused pensioners and mutated aliens in order to win the title and fulfil their dreams. Throughout these encounters, players will need to input correctly-timed moves through classic rhythm gameplay; albeit with a twist that sees you battling opponents with an array of power-ups and super moves, from grenades to donuts!
Featuring a unique manga art style and 18 unique tracks that pay homage to its Japanese inspiration, fans of the rhythm/music genre are sure to find their beat in the Super Dodgeball Beats’s single-player story mode and local multiplayer offering.
Super Dodgeball Beats is expected launch on 22nd August for Xbox One, PlayStation 4, Nintendo Switch and PC, priced at £11.99.
